- Set clear goals: Before starting your day, take 10 minutes to write down your top 3-5 goals. This will help you stay focused on what's important.
- Use a Pomodoro timer: Work in focused 25-minute increments, followed by a 5-minute break. This can help you stay on track and avoid burnout.
- Eliminate distractions: Identify common distractions (social media, email, phone notifications), and eliminate them while you work. Use a tool like Freedom or SelfControl to block distracting websites.
- Prioritize tasks: Use the Eisenhower Matrix to categorize tasks into urgent vs. important, and focus on the most critical ones first.
- Take breaks: Taking regular breaks can help you recharge and come back to your work with renewed focus. Use your breaks to do something enjoyable or relaxing.
- Stay organized: Use a task management tool like Todoist or Trello to keep track of your tasks and deadlines.
- Avoid multitasking: Try to focus on a single task at a time. Multitasking can actually decrease productivity and increase stress.
- Use music to your advantage: Listen to music that helps you focus. Some studies suggest that listening to classical music, in particular, can improve cognitive function.
- Get enough sleep: Lack of sleep can significantly decrease productivity. Aim for 7-9 hours of sleep per night.
- Review and adjust: At the end of each day/week, take a few minutes to review what you've accomplished and adjust your plan for the next day/week.

Typical component choices
- Motors: 1404–2207 size depending on prop choice and desired thrust
- ESCs: 20–45 A BLHeli_32 or similar (prefer DShot-capable)
- Flight controller: 20x20 or 30.5x30.5 mounting options; Betaflight/Cleanflight compatible
- Camera: 16:9 or 4:3 FPV camera, micro-size to reduce weight
- VTX: 25–800 mW depending on local regs and range needs
- Props: 3–4 inch 3-blade or 2-blade polycarbonate
